Smith, Marion age 94, a life-time public servant including stints with Northern Pump, Mpls. Public Schools & the Bureau of Naval Research. Has been reassigned to a new position. While this reassignment includes permanent relocation, the benefits include a reunion of family and friends she has not seen in a long time. Including husband Ed; brother Arvo; sister Sarah and son Brad. Additional benefits include guarantee 300 score every time she bowls, 3 cherries with every pull at the slot machine, doorside parking at the Hopkins VFW Post #425 and no green fees at any course of her choice. Left to plan her "retirement party" at a later date are son Doug (Shawna); daughter Wendy (Jeff) Foster; sister-in-law Blanche Pietrzak; grandchildren Eric, Shauna & Bailey Smith and Chad, Chase & Alex Foster and Aja St. Peter; great grandchildren Sydra, Paige and Paityn. Also the fun and beloved Pietrzak, Rannow and Sullivan families. Sisu.
